What distinguishes hot storage from cold storage for data?

Hot storage and cold storage refer to different methods of data storage that have varied purposes and performance characteristics. Hot storage is characterized by its high accessibility and speed, making it ideal for data that needs to be frequently accessed or processed. This type of storage is typically utilized for active data—information that is currently in use, such as databases and applications that require quick retrieval by users or systems.

Cold storage, on the other hand, is designed for archival purposes and is generally used to store data that is infrequently accessed, such as backups or historical records. Since this data does not need to be retrieved immediately, cold storage systems can afford to be slower and less accessible. This distinction means that cold storage often relies on slower media such as magnetic tapes or offsite servers that are not readily connected to the network.

With cold storage, retrieving data typically takes longer and may require additional steps, compared to the instant access that hot storage provides. This characteristic is essential for organizations deciding how to allocate their storage resources based on their data access needs and operational priorities.
